FCFC Spring 2025 Season FAQs
In Spring 2025, our recreational teams for boys and girls will play in the JUSA interleague, meaning that FCFC recreational teams will play against other local recreational teams from Placentia, Yorba Linda, La Mirada, etc.
Spring season practices will begin the week of February 17. Practices will likely be held once a week in Fullerton (maybe twice if the coach and team agree). Games will begin the weekend of March 15-16. Games will be on Saturdays and Sundays. Home games will be on Fullerton fields. We will attempt to schedule all home games for Sundays after 12:00.

FCFC is a newly established organization that launched its inaugural season in Fall 2024. As we build our league, we’re focused on ensuring we have enough registered players to form teams across divisions, organized by age and gender. Our goal is to create divisions with at least four teams each. In the event we are unable to field four teams in a division, we will collaborate with JUSA, a youth soccer organization based in Placentia and Yorba Linda, to create an "inter-league." This partnership will allow FCFC recreational teams to compete with recreational teams from JUSA, as well as nearby La Mirada and La Habra, ensuring a vibrant and engaging season for all players.
How many practices will be held during the Spring 2025 season?
Each recreational team will have 1-2 practices per week.
The coach of each recreational team will decide whether to hold one or two practices.
Select teams will hold 2 or more practices per week (subject to agreement between coach and team).

How much does the Spring 2025 season cost:
U5-U6: FREE (includes uniform). Let’s goooo!
U7-U8: Boys and Girls Recreational: $110 (includes uniform)
U9 and older: Boys and Girls Recreational: $125 (includes uniform)
All ages: Boys and Girls Select: $195 (does not include game kits
Kits for Select teams will cost approximately $200 and will include two custom FCFC game uniforms (jerseys, shorts, and socks) and a practice uniform (yellow Nike shirt, shorts and socks). At this time, FCFC has no plans to replace the current game kits.
Costs include referee fees (where applicable).
Select Teams may choose to attend various tournaments throughout the year. The $195 fee does not include tournament fees or potential food and lodging costs associated with certain tournaments.
How do I select an Age Division?
Player’s soccer age should be calculated using the player’s birth year (“Birth Year” format). To calculate a player's soccer age (e.g. U10) for registration purposes, subtract the child's birth year from the end of the seasonal year. For example: In the Fall 2024- Spring 2025 seasonal year, if your child is born in 2015 and the seasonal year ends in 2025, the calculation is 2025 - 2015 = 10. Your child's soccer age is U10. In other words, U10 = Birth Year 2015.
There has been a lot of discussion amongst the national and regional youth soccer organizations about replacing the current Birth Year format with the School Year format (e.g. Aug. 1 – July 31). If there is a change at the national or regional level, FCFC intends to implement that change and apply the School Year format when creating divisions.
